Explore distributed graph techniques in the Massively Parallel Computation (MPC) model through this 46-minute lecture by Quanquan C. Liu from Northwestern University. Delve into the intersection of fine-grained complexity, logic, and query evaluation as part of the Simons Institute's series on advanced computational concepts. Gain insights into how these techniques can be applied to solve complex graph problems in distributed computing environments.
